一、windows环境下的启动
bin目录结构:
启动mongDB服务:
bin\mongod.exe。默认使用c:\data\db作为数据目录,可在启动时通过dbpath参数指定数据目录:bin\mongod.exe --dbpath=data/db。默认使用27017端口。
mongoDB还会启动一个非常基本的HTTP服务器,监听数字比主端口号高1000的端口,28017端口。可通过浏览器访问http://localhost:28017/来获取数据库的管理信息。
mongoDB Shell:
mongoDB自带一个Javascript Shell,可以从命令行与mongoDB实例交互。启动方式:bin\mongo.exe
会在相对路径data/db中创建相应的数据文件。
二、基本概念
1、文档:
多个键及其关联的值有序地放置在一起便是文档。每种编程语言表示文档的方式不太一样,但大多数语言都有相通的一种数据结构,比如映射、散列或字典。例,在javascript中,文档表示为对象:{"greeting":"hello world!"},JSON格式
2、集合:
集合就是一组文档。如果说mongDB中的文档类似于关系型数据库中的行,那么集合就如同表
3、数据库:
多个文档组成集合,同样多个集合组成数据库。一个mongoDB实例可以承载多个数据库,它们之间可视为完全独立的。
三、基本shell命令
(1)show dbs:查询所有数据库
> show dbs;
egDB 0.0625GB
local 0.03125GB
>
(2)use xx:选择使用某个数据库
> use egDB
switched to db egDB
>
(3)show collections:显示当前所选择的数据库的所有集合
> show collections
student
system.indexes
(4)查询集合中的数据
> db.student.find();
{ "_id" : ObjectId("5221678247f0052b96663e45"), "name" : "eg366" }

@Test
public void updateStudent1() {
System.out.println("############ updateStudent1() #############");
try {
Mongo connection = ConnectionUtil.getInstance(host, port);
DB db = connection.getDB("egDB");
DBCollection students = db.getCollection("student");
/* 根据ID更新 */
/* 此种做法是错误的,根据ID查询到的对象将会被替换为一个新的对象,用该用$set的方式 */
// WriteResult wr = students.update(new BasicDBObject("_id", new ObjectId("52216efb47f0801f6618da1a")),
// new BasicDBObject("age", 26).append("createTime", new Date()));
WriteResult wr = students.update(new BasicDBObject("_id", new ObjectId("5221765f47f0b93d273f68c9")),
new BasicDBObject("$set", new BasicDBObject("age", 26).append("createTime", new Date())));
System.out.println("Error: " + wr.getError());
System.out.println("update count: " + wr.getN());
} catch (UnknownHostException e) {
e.printStackTrace();
}
}
